Job Description

HealthScribe is currently seeking a Medical Scribe candidate who would like to gain valuable experience working one-on-one with physicians.

This paid, part-time position is perfect for a student seeking a career in healthcare who would like to gain more experience and exposure in a clinical setting before starting professional school. Scribing is an incredible experience, teaching you an extensive base of medical knowledge and on-the-job exposure in a clinical setting. This position is ideal for students & alumni looking to get into medical, PA or nursing school or who plan to work in the medical field.

Don't have scribing experience? No problem. Qualified applicants undergo approximately 100 hours of training for the medical scribe role. HealthScribe is offering part-time positions in a clinic Monday-Friday 7am-5pm.

Requirements

  • Must have a high school diploma. College degree or current enrollment in a 4 year program highly recommended.
  • Must demonstrate ability to clearly and concisely communicate, orally and in writing.
  • Must demonstrate a high level of maturity and possess strong interpersonal & organizational skills.
  • Minimum typing speed of 60 WPM.
  • Computer literate.
  • Commitment of 12 months.
  • Must be available to work a minimum of 2-3, eight hour shifts per week equaling 16-24 hours. Shifts will be during clinic hours, Monday-Friday approximately 7am to 5pm.
